Segment Information Segment Information
The Company operates under two reportable segments: Commercial and Residential. This is consistent with how our chief operating decision maker (“CODM”), who is our Chief Executive Officer (“CEO”), evaluates performance and allocates resources.
Segment net sales include sales of equipment and services by our segments. Segment Adjusted EBITDA is determined based on performance measures used by our CODM. Our CODM uses Segment Adjusted EBITDA to assess performance and allocate resources to each segment, primarily through periodic budgeting and segment performance reviews. In connection with that assessment our CODM may exclude matters, such as significant, higher-cost restructuring programs, depreciation and amortization, and other costs determined by the CODM not to be reflective of the ongoing performance of the segment. Segment Adjusted EBITDA excludes results reported as discontinued operations.
The Company places more emphasis on segment profit and loss than it does on segment assets. As a result, the Company’s CODM does not assess performance, make strategic decisions, or allocate resources based on assets at the segment level. Accordingly, asset information is not disclosed by reportable segment.

(1)Exclusive of intangible amortization shown separately.
(2)Segment EBITDA add-backs primarily include adjustments to remove depreciation and non-recurring items. Commercial segment EBITDA add-backs for depreciation were $6.6 and $6.4 for the three months ended June 30, 2026 and 2025, respectively, and $13.1 and $12.6 for the six months ended June 30, 2026 and 2025, respectively. Residential segment EBITDA add-backs for depreciation were $6.3 and $6.1 for the three months ended June 30, 2026 and 2025, respectively, and $12.8 and $10.0, for the six months ended June 30, 2026 and 2025, respectively. Commercial segment EBITDA add-backs for purchase accounting adjustments were $1.7 and $1.7 for the three and six months ended June 30, 2025, respectively. Residential segment EBITDA add-back for purchase accounting adjustments were $5.3 and $5.3 for the three and six months ended June 30, 2025, respectively.
(3)Primarily includes central selling, general and administrative expenses and gains and losses on foreign currency. For the six months ended June 30, 2025, this includes a $3.9 gain on legal settlement.
(4)Direct and indirect support from Holdings for certain central activities including, but not limited to consolidation accounting, tax services, legal, and other Holdings central and infrastructure related services.
(5)Includes a $27.7 loss on the extinguishment of debt for the three and six months ended June 30, 2026.
